Who is Bear Brown? A Wilderness Icon

Bear Brown, born on June 10, 1987, is currently 38 years old and a key figure in the Discovery Channel’s Alaskan Bush People. The show, which premiered in 2014, follows the Brown family’s off-grid life in Alaska and Washington. Bear, the third eldest of seven siblings, earned his nickname for his fearless, animal-like agility in the wild. His height of 6 feet 2 inches and athletic build make him a standout, whether he’s climbing trees or hunting for survival. Unlike typical reality stars, Bear’s raw connection to nature defines his identity, offering viewers a glimpse into a life unbound by modern constraints.

Bear Brown’s Net Worth and Salary in 2025

Bear Brown’s net worth in 2025 is estimated between $300,000 and $500,000, primarily from his role on Alaskan Bush People. His salary reportedly ranges from $20,000 to $40,000 per season, though exact figures vary due to the show’s collective family earnings, estimated at $60 million overall. Unlike traditional celebrities, Bear’s income is tied to the show’s success and his family’s unique brand of wilderness living. Additional ventures, like potential book deals or appearances, remain speculative but could boost his wealth.

Is Bear Brown Married? Dating and Relationship Updates

Bear Brown’s marital status has been a hot topic. He married Raiven Adams in January 2022, but the couple divorced in 2024 after three years, citing irreconcilable differences. They share three sons, including River, born in 2020. As of 2025, Bear is reportedly single, with no confirmed dating rumors. His past relationships, including a tumultuous engagement with Raiven, have been public, with fans speculating about his romantic future on social media.

Personal Life and Family Dynamics

Bear’s family, led by his late father Billy Brown (died 2021) and mother Ami Brown, remains central to his story. His siblings—Matt, Joshua, Gabriel, Noah, Snowbird, and Rain—share the Alaskan Bush People spotlight. The family’s “wolf pack” mentality, living isolated from society, has shaped Bear’s worldview.
